Ophiophagy (Greek: ὄφις + φαγία, lit. ' snake eating ') is a specialized form of feeding or alimentary behavior of animals which hunt and eat snakes.There are ophiophagous mammals (such as the skunks and the mongooses), birds (such as snake eagles, the secretarybird, and some hawks), lizards (such as the common collared lizard), and even other snakes, such as the Central and South ...

Oligophagy is a term for intermediate degrees of selectivity, referring to animals that eat a relatively small range of foods, either because of preference or necessity. [2] Another classification refers to the specific food animals specialize in eating, such as: Carnivore: the eating of animals Araneophagy: eating spiders; Avivore: eating birds
While birds, including raptors, wading birds and roadrunners, and mammals are known to prey on reptiles, the major predator is other reptiles. Some reptiles eat reptile eggs, for example the diet of the Nile monitor includes crocodile eggs, and small reptiles are preyed upon by larger ones. [33]

While reptiles and amphibians can be quite similar externally, the French zoologist Pierre André Latreille recognized the large physiological differences at the beginning of the 19th century and split the herptiles into two classes, giving the four familiar classes of tetrapods: amphibians, reptiles, birds and mammals.
All snakes are strictly carnivorous, preying on small animals including lizards, frogs, other snakes, small mammals, birds, eggs, fish, snails, worms, and insects.
